AI Platforms for Smart Home Integration

In recent years, the integration of artificial intelligence (AI) platforms into smart homes has become increasingly popular. These platforms can provide a wide range of benefits, from enhancing convenience and security to improving energy efficiency and home management. In this article, we will explore the various AI platforms available for smart home integration and how they can enhance the overall functionality of your home.

One of the most well-known AI platforms for smart home integration is Amazon’s Alexa. Alexa is a virtual assistant that can be used to control various smart home devices, such as lights, thermostats, and security cameras, using voice commands. With Alexa, users can easily create routines that automate certain tasks, such as turning off the lights and locking the doors at night. Alexa also has a wide range of skills that allow users to access information, play music, and even order products online.

Another popular AI platform for smart home integration is Google Assistant. Google Assistant is available on a variety of devices, including smartphones, smart speakers, and smart displays. Like Alexa, Google Assistant can be used to control smart home devices and create routines. Google Assistant also has the ability to answer questions, provide weather updates, and even make phone calls.

Apple’s Siri is another AI platform that can be used for smart home integration. Siri is available on Apple devices, such as iPhones, iPads, and HomePods. With Siri, users can control their smart home devices using voice commands and create shortcuts for automating tasks. Siri also has the ability to send messages, set reminders, and provide recommendations based on user preferences.

In addition to these major AI platforms, there are also a number of third-party platforms that can be used for smart home integration. These platforms, such as Samsung SmartThings, Wink, and Hubitat, offer a wide range of compatibility with different smart home devices and allow users to create customized automation routines.

One of the key benefits of using AI platforms for smart home integration is the ability to centralize control of all your smart devices. Instead of having to use multiple apps to control different devices, users can simply use their preferred AI platform to manage all their devices in one place. This not only enhances convenience but also allows for greater customization and automation of tasks.

AI platforms also have the ability to learn user preferences and habits over time, allowing them to anticipate user needs and provide personalized recommendations. For example, an AI platform may learn that a user likes to turn on the lights at a certain time each day and automatically do so without the user having to give a command.

Another benefit of using AI platforms for smart home integration is the ability to remotely monitor and control your home. Whether you are at work, on vacation, or simply in another room of your house, you can use your AI platform to check in on your home security cameras, adjust your thermostat, or turn off lights that were accidentally left on.

In terms of energy efficiency, AI platforms can help users optimize their energy usage by analyzing data from smart home devices and suggesting ways to reduce energy consumption. For example, an AI platform may recommend adjusting the thermostat settings or turning off lights in unused rooms to save energy and lower utility bills.

Overall, AI platforms offer a wide range of benefits for smart home integration, from enhancing convenience and security to improving energy efficiency and home management. By centralizing control of smart devices, learning user preferences, and providing personalized recommendations, AI platforms can greatly enhance the functionality of a smart home.

FAQs:

Q: Are AI platforms secure for smart home integration?

A: AI platforms are designed with security in mind and use encryption and authentication protocols to protect user data and privacy. However, it is important for users to follow best practices for securing their smart home devices, such as using strong passwords and keeping software up to date.

Q: Can AI platforms work with all smart home devices?

A: Most AI platforms are designed to work with a wide range of smart home devices, but compatibility can vary depending on the brand and model of the device. It is important to check the compatibility of your devices with your chosen AI platform before making a purchase.

Q: Can AI platforms be used to monitor multiple homes?

A: Yes, AI platforms can be used to monitor and control multiple homes, as long as the devices in each home are connected to the same AI platform. Users can switch between homes within the AI platform to access and control devices in each location.

Q: How can I get started with AI platforms for smart home integration?

A: To get started with AI platforms for smart home integration, you will need to choose a platform that is compatible with your smart home devices. Once you have selected a platform, you can set up your devices, create automation routines, and begin using voice commands to control your smart home.
